Who should pick which
- NLP ResearcherPick: Gensim
Gensim provides state-of-the-art topic modeling and word embedding training tailored for large text corpora.
- High School Student Applying to US UniversitiesPick: Reach Best
Reach Best offers admission chance prediction and AI essay feedback specifically for undergraduate applicants.
- Data Scientist Building Text Similarity SystemPick: Gensim
Gensim's similarity queries and streaming capabilities are ideal for production-scale document similarity tasks.
- International Student Applying to UK UniversitiesPick: Reach Best
Reach Best supports multi-country search including the UK and provides profile matching with past applicants.
